Detailed description
This study will be a phase I study to assess the pharmacodynamics of AZD9977 following single-dose administration to healthy male subjects. It is a single-blind (with regards to AZD9977 and AZD9977 Placebo), randomized, four-treatment, four-period crossover design, with a potential 5th and 6th randomized cross-over treatment period. In this study eplerenone is used as a positive control and fludrocortisone will be used as a challenge agent. In addition the safety, tolerability and pharmacokinetics will be assessed.

Interventions
|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| DRUG | AZD9977 oral suspension | AZD9977 oral suspension, single dose |
| DRUG | AZD9977 placebo oral suspension | oral suspension, single dose |
| DRUG | Fludrocortisone, tablets | Loading dose of 0.5 mg and maintenance doses of 0.1 mg every second hour up to a total dose of 1.0 mg per treatment period (may be modified to up to 1.3 mg based on emerging data) |
| DRUG | Eplerenone, tablets | 100 mg (2 x 50 mg tablets) single dose, may be modified based on emerging data (will not exceed 500 mg per treatment period) |
